This Easter Kellogg’s has partnered with Morrisons to launch a breakfast club where the whole family can request a free bowl of cereal.

Both adults and children can choose from a bowl of Cornflakes, Rice Krispies or Coco Pops, with a choice of dairy and non-dairy milk, when they order a ‘Kellogg’s breakfast’ before 11am, in any of Morrisons 397 cafés.

 

The joint initiative will run from 3rd to 24th April, while stock lasts, and aims to support families during the Easter holidays when many school breakfast clubs are unavailable.

Safer Neighbourhoods officers police the area you live in and deal with local issues, including crime and anti-social behaviour. You can contact them directly, by email. Please note these mailboxes are not monitored 24/7 and as such should be used for non-urgent matters. In an emergency always dial 999 or 101 for non-emergency calls. If you are unsure what team represents the area where you live, check the postcode finder on met.police.uk
